Pine leaf, the scientific name of traditional Chinese medicine.

It is the needle of Pinus massoniana, Pinus Taiwan Province and Pinus massoniana. ,PinusthunbergiiParl。 Pinus tabulaeformis and Pinus yunnanensis. And PinuskoraiensisSied.et.Zucc

Pinus armandii is distributed in the southwest and Shaanxi, Gansu, Henan, Hubei, Tibet and other places.

Pinus taiwanensis is distributed in Anhui, Jiangxi, Zhejiang, Fujian, Taiwan Province, Henan, Hubei, Hunan and other places.

Masson pine is distributed in Shaanxi, Jiangsu, An Wei, Zhejiang, Jiangxi, Fujian, Taiwan Province, Henan, Hubei, Hunan, Guangdong, Guangxi, Sichuan, Guizhou and Yunnan.

Black pine is distributed in Liaoning, Shandong and Jiangsu. It is cultivated in Nanjing, Shanghai and Hangzhou.

Pinus tabulaeformis is distributed in Northeast China, North China, Northwest China, Henan, Shandong, Jiangsu and other places.

Pinus yunnanensis is distributed in southwest China and Guangxi.

Korean pine is distributed in the northeast of China.

Has the effects of expelling pathogenic wind, removing dampness, killing insects, relieving itching, promoting blood circulation and calming the nerves.

Commonly used for rheumatic joint pain, beriberi, wet sore, tinea, rubella itching, traumatic injury, neurasthenia, chronic nephritis, hypertension, and prevention of Japanese encephalitis and influenza.

Nutritional value of pine needles

It is rich in crude protein, fat, trace elements and vitamins.

According to the determination, pine needle powder contains crude protein 7%- 12%, total amino acids such as lysine and aspartic acid 5.5%-8. 1%, crude fat 7%- 12%, nitrogen-free extract 37% and ash 2%-6%. The content of vitamin C is 540-650mg/kg, chlorophyll is 700-2200mg/kg, and pine needle powder contains metabolic energy 16.72-30.90mJ/kg.

The practice of loosening the needle

Pine needle drink

Materials: pine needles 5- 10g, 9 purple grapes, 4 pears 1/,honey1teaspoon, and 200cc of cold boiled water.

Exercise:

1. Wash pine needles, grapes and pears, peel and core pears and cut them into small pieces.

2. Put all the materials into a juicer with a strainer, stir at high speed 1 min, and pour the filtered juice into a cup.

Add honey and stir well.

Tips pine needles, grape skins and grape seeds are astringent, grape meat and pears are very sweet, and juice is not astringent without honey.

Therefore, friends who need to control their weight can avoid drinking honey and reduce their calorie intake.
